How to get started on a Business in Namibia
Prior to deciding to sign-up your organization, take the time to strategy effectively:
Build a Business Plan
Recognize what services or products you will give. Validate your thought via marketplace investigate.
Opt for a Business Composition
In Namibia, the widespread buildings are:
Sole Proprietor – Informal, easiest to get started on, but no lawful separation in between you and the business enterprise
Near Corporation (CC) – Well known with modest companies; lets 1–10 members
Non-public Enterprise (Pty) Ltd – Greatest for rising businesses or These with external traders

Ways to Sign up a Company in Namibia
Enterprise registration in Namibia is completed throughout the Organization and Mental House Authority (BIPA). Comply with these methods:
Stage 1: Reserve a Company Identify
Head over to www.bipa.na or go to their Business
Submit Sort CM5 with approximately six title selections
Pay the reservation cost (about NAD 50–75)
Wait around 2–5 days for approval
Phase two: Put together Registration Paperwork
For an in depth Company, post:
Sort CC1 (Founding Assertion)
Accredited ID copies of all customers
Evidence of tackle
For A non-public Enterprise, post:
CM2 (Memorandum of Affiliation)
CM22 (Registered Business)
CM29 (Director details)
Action 3: Fork out Registration Costs
CC registration expenses around NAD two hundred–350
(Pty) Ltd registration expenses NAD 450–one,000 based upon irrespective of whether you employ professional assistance
Stage four: Register for Tax and Social Protection
Visit NamRA to sign-up for tax and VAT (if desired)
Register While using the Social Safety Fee for personnel contributions
Stage 5: Receive a Trade License (if essential)
Apply for a trade license at your neighborhood municipal Business. Most retail, services, and food items-related organizations have to have a person.

Starting up a company in Namibia to be a Foreigner
Foreigners can where to register a business in namibia sign-up a company in Namibia, but Here are a few additional necessities:
Register a proper entity – Generally a Pty Ltd or Near Company
Obtain an investor or get the job done allow – Apply throughout the Ministry of Dwelling Affairs
Adjust to nearby rules – This features tax, labor, and licensing guidelines
Open a Namibian bank account – Essential for all money transactions
Foreigners are inspired to operate with a neighborhood authorized or enterprise guide for clean registration and compliance.
